recent pattern is constructive. Over 1 month and 3 months, the fund stayed in positive territory, while the benchmark was more uneven and even negative over the 1-month stretch. That tells us the fund has kept a steadier profile in the very short term, which is useful for investors who want less day-to-day movement than an equity-like benchmark.<\/p>\n<p>The longer view is also consistent. The 1-year return of 6.63% is close to the 3-year figure of 7.35% and the 5-year figure of 6.54%, which suggests the fund has delivered a fairly stable compounding path rather than sharp jumps followed by pullbacks. The benchmark\u2019s 1-year return is negative, so the fund has clearly been ahead over that period, while the 3-year and 5-year spreads are narrower.<\/p>\n<p>That mix matters. The fund is not built to outrun a broad equity index over every window, but its return pattern shows more consistency across horizons than the benchmark\u2019s recent behaviour. For debt investors, that consistency is often more relevant than headline outperformance in a single period.<\/p>\n<p>Overall, the fund looks more controlled than volatile, with the short-term pattern broadly aligned to the longer-term trend.
